The sheep with reportedly the world's "heaviest" fleece, named Chris, passed away in Australia, its caretakers have announced. Chris became famous for its heavy fleece which led to it getting worldwide attention in 2015. The sheep which lived on a farm refused to be caught by its owners for regular fleecing and had reportedly collected fleece which was noted by its owners as something a sheep would have collected if it did not shed for a period of six years. It even made World record for the amount of wool that was collected after the excess wool was fleeced; notably, the fleeced hair weighed at about 41.6 kg.

Care-takers posted the sad news

Little Oak Sanctuary posted two pictures of Chris along with a note informing everyone about the demise of the sheep. They wrote that they have heartbreaking news to share that Chris the sheep, has passed away. In the message posted, the care-takers added that Chris was known as the world record holder for having grown the heaviest fleece on record. However, the sheep they knew was much more than just that and they will all remember it for its personality. The post received a lot of reshares, sad reactions and comments to it ever since it was uploaded.
